Remember how on the toddler birthday post I mentioned that we went over our grocery budget and I had instituted a no-spend week for the last week (really about week and a half) of the month? I wanted to give an update on how its been going.
So far, it hasnt been too bad. We had a lot of leftover food from the birthday party so Ive been eating a hot dog every day for lunch (luckily, there are about a million different ways to dress up a hot dog, so it actually hasnt been too boring). We also have a couple chicken sausages still left that Im planning to chop up and put into a pasta dish for dinner tonight (they need to get eaten!)
I also had a big pork butt roast in the freezer that Ive been making into different meals. The first night we had it as a roast (with carrots and potatoes I already had on hand as sides). Then I shredded all the remaining pork and split it into two halves. Half of the remains are destined for pulled BBQ pork sandwiches (we have some hamburger buns in the freezer we can use), and the other half were made into carnitas tacos (I make homemade tortillas).
Perhaps the hardest part has been trying to figure out what to do with the girls all day. Its so hot that its not safe to be outside playing for more than 5 minutes and I often used grocery shopping as a crutch for a thing we could do to fill our time. I dont want to spend a bunch of money for the childrens museum or other paid events. Instead, weve gone to the play area at the mall, story time at the library, and to play at the childrens area at my new gym. Weve also gone to the pool once (we have a community pool thats free for us), and had one play date with friends.
